Los Angeles CA: Police activity escalated against protestors as ICE began unjustifiable raids on immigrant communities and workplaces. This comes as the Trump administration proceeds in it’s deportation campaign which aims to embody Operation Wetback, President Eisenhower’s mass deportation operation which infamously removed one million people from the country, at times deporting US citizens as well.
The National Guard has been deployed by the administration in order to confront peaceful protests which seek to defend community members from their unjust removal from the country. This has demonstrated a clear escalation on behalf of our leaders against communities which are exercising their right to organize a protest and to engage in free speech.
The Trump administration repeatedly claimed during it’s presidential bid that their mass deportation campaign would target criminals, however, it’s been clear that ICE agents have been targeting workers, mothers, and community members while threatening deportations and separations of families. It is also worth noting that Immigrants commit less crime per capita than US born citizens, highlighting how the administration attempts to procure consent for an unjust deportation campaign by stroking unfounded fears of “increased crime”.
